Which kind of virus is HIV? What is the enzyme reverse transcriptase present in the HIV?
Expert
HIV is a retrovirus, that is, RNA viral (its inherited material is RNA and not DNA).Reverse transcriptase is a particular enzyme of the retrovirus accountable for the transcription of the viral RNA in DNA in the infected (host) cell. This DNA then commands production of viral proteins and viral replication.
